MySQL是世界上最流行的開源數(shù)據(jù)庫之一,具有高性能、可靠性和易于使用的特點。在MySQL中讀取數(shù)據(jù)是非常常見的操作,本文將介紹一些常用的讀取數(shù)據(jù)的方法。
SELECT
SELECT
是最常用的查詢語句,可以用它從一個或多個表中檢索數(shù)據(jù)。語法如下:
SELECT column1, column2, ... FROM table_name WHERE condition;
其中,column1, column2, ...
是要檢索的列的名稱,table_name
是要檢索數(shù)據(jù)的表的名稱,condition
是可選的,用于設(shè)置查詢的篩選條件。
SELECT * FROM
如果要檢索表中的所有列,可以使用SELECT *
語句。例如:
SELECT * FROM table_name;
這將返回表中的所有行和列。
ORDER BY
如果需要按照某一列的值進行排序,可以使用ORDER BY
子句。語法如下:
SELECT column1, column2, ... FROM table_name ORDER BY column1;
其中,column1
是要按照其值排序的列的名稱。
GROUP BY
如果要按照某一列的值對結(jié)果進行分組,可以使用GROUP BY
子句。語法如下:
SELECT column1, column2, ... FROM table_name GROUP BY column1;
其中,column1
是要按照其值進行分組的列的名稱。注意,GROUP BY
返回的結(jié)果不是按照行排序的,因此需要使用ORDER BY
進行排序。
LIMIT
如果只想檢索表中的前幾行,可以使用LIMIT
語句。語法如下:
SELECT column1, column2, ... FROM table_name LIMIT num_rows;
其中,num_rows
是要檢索的行數(shù)。
以上是MySQL中常用的讀取數(shù)據(jù)的方法,可以根據(jù)需要選擇適合自己的方法。